Hebrew word study

יְעוּץYᵉʻûwts Jeuts, an Israelite

Pronounced “yeh-oots'

Jeuts, an Israelite

Translated in the King James as: Jeuz

Origin: from H5779 (עוּץ); counsellor;

Read it in context & ask Abram about this word

Where it appears

1 Chronicles 1×
1 Chr 8:10
